Output fac3d32e777c931cf4141c69a5eaae8f745e30dfdf15f2c14081748076250ab1:22

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66b03daaacf649ee799d2f2c16d8f37cd3e1761eed4bf54e1dc53afd08a96441
address
bc1pv6crm24v7ey7u7va9ukpdk8n0nf7zas7a49l2nsac5a06z9fv3qsl0j462
transaction
fac3d32e777c931cf4141c69a5eaae8f745e30dfdf15f2c14081748076250ab1
spent
true